Event Information

 Moonstruck at Midnight

Expressions of Chocolate Vol. II

A Benefit Concert supporting Childhood Cancer

 

Michael Allen Harrison on Piano 

Dance performances by Polaris Dance Theater

Arlene Schnitzer Concert Hall – 9:00 PM

Wednesday, December 31, 2008

 

On New Year’s Eve 2008, Northwest recording artist Michael Allen Harrison will lead the way to an evening filled with the sights, sounds and tastes of chocolate!  Moonstruck at Midnight - Expressions of Chocolate Vol. II a benefit for childhood cancer, will feature music from Michael’s magnificent CD, “Expressions of Chocolate, Volume II”, accompanied by creative dance performances by Portland’s Polaris Dance Theater.  Under the artistic direction of Robert Guitron, the Polaris Dance company will interpret the richness of the music created by Michael Allen Harrison and inspired by the artistry of Moonstruck Master Chocolatier, Julian Rose.  Each member of the audience will sample exquisite handmade Moonstruck chocolates as they take in the beauty of the show.  Moonstruck at Midnight will embrace the sweetness of life and the pleasures of a much celebrated confection. 

 With the assistance of corporate sponsors and dozens of volunteers, 100% of the net proceeds from Moonstruck at Midnight will go directly to two local organizations involved in the treatment of childhood cancer.
